Reciprocal control of viral infection and phosphoinositide dynamics

open access: yesFEBS Letters, EarlyView.
Phosphoinositides, although scarce, regulate key cellular processes, including membrane dynamics and signaling. Viruses exploit these lipids to support their entry, replication, assembly, and egress. The central role of phosphoinositides in infection highlights phosphoinositide metabolism as a promising antiviral target.

Dispersive properties of gradient-dependent and rate-dependent media

open access: yesMechanics of Materials, 1994
The dispersive behaviour of waves propagating in gradient-dependent and rate-dependent media is investigated analytically and numerically. Attention is focused on the proper modelling of dynamic strain localisation and the crucial role that dispersion plays in this.
